
On March 25, 2026, the William J. Perry Center for Hemispheric Defense Studies conducted academic engagements with professional military education institutions in Argentina, including the Joint War College (Escuela Superior de Guerra Conjunta, ESGC) and the Armed Forces Intelligence Institute (Instituto de Inteligencia de las Fuerzas Armadas, IIFA).
The Perry Center delegation included Professors Arturo Sotomayor and Jeffrey Zinsmeister, and Alumni Affairs Coordinator Georgina Crovetto. At ESGC, the delegation delivered a presentation addressing Chinese engagement in the Western Hemisphere and its implications for critical infrastructure, nuclear energy in Latin America, the space domain, and cybersecurity and national defense.
Later that day, at IIFA, the delegation presented on the 2025-26 US National Security Strategy, including its key priorities, regional implications, and relevance for Argentina and Latin America, followed by an exchange with participants.
Dr. Julio Spota, President of Argentina’s National Defense University (UNDEF); Colonel (ret.) Alberto Victorio Aparicio, Dean of the Joint Military Faculty; Brigadier General Esteban Guillermo Ledesma Cuoto, Director of ESGC; and Colonel Facundo Martín Federico Zorzi, Director of IIFA, supported and hosted these engagements.
